Hodnotenie:
Kniha je všeobecne považovaná za solídny úvod do jazyka PHP a pokrýva širokú škálu základných tém, takže je vhodná aj pre začiatočníkov. Nezaoberá sa však hlbšími alebo pokročilejšími koncepciami, čo viedlo k určitej nespokojnosti čitateľov, ktorí očakávali komplexnejšie pokrytie.
Výhody:⬤ Poskytuje solídny základ pre začiatočníkov v programovaní v PHP.
⬤ Pokrýva rôzne témy týkajúce sa jazyka PHP a vývoja dynamických webových stránok.
⬤ Je užitočný na osvojenie si terminológie potrebnej na skúmanie frameworkov.
⬤ Informatívny a celkovo obsahuje dobré informácie.
⬤ Chýbajú mu hĺbkové detaily a preberá dôležité pojmy, ktoré sú pre nováčikov nevyhnutné.
⬤ Chýbajúce čísla strán sťažujú akademické využitie.
⬤ Niektoré kapitoly sú náročné na pochopenie a nie sú vhodné pre skutočných začiatočníkov.
⬤ Vynecháva významné funkcie a aktualizácie v PHP
⬤ 4, ako je nová syntax polí, variabilné parametre a široko používané nástroje, ako je Composer.
(na základe 6 čitateľských recenzií)
Programming PHP: Creating Dynamic Web Pages
Prečo je PHP najpoužívanejším programovacím jazykom na webe? Toto aktualizované vydanie vás naučí všetko, čo potrebujete vedieť na vytváranie efektívnych webových aplikácií s využitím najnovších funkcií jazyka PHP 7. 4. Začnete od všeobecného prehľadu a potom sa ponoríte do syntaxe jazyka, programovacích techník a ďalších detailov na príkladoch, ktoré ilustrujú správne použitie aj bežné idiómy.
Ak máte praktické znalosti jazyka HTML, autori Kevin Tatroe a Peter MacIntyre vám jasným a stručným spôsobom poskytnú množstvo tipov na štýl a praktických rád pre programovanie, ktoré vám pomôžu stať sa špičkovým programátorom v jazyku PHP.
⬤ Pochopte, čo všetko je možné pri používaní programov v jazyku PHP.
⬤ Oboznámte sa so základmi jazyka vrátane dátových typov, premenných, operátorov a príkazov na riadenie toku.
⬤ Preskúmajte funkcie, reťazce, polia a objekty.
⬤ Použiť bežné techniky webových aplikácií, ako je spracovanie formulárov, overovanie údajov, sledovanie relácie a súbory cookie.
⬤ Interakcia s relačnými databázami, ako je MySQL, alebo databázami NoSQL, ako je MongoDB.
⬤ Generovať dynamické obrázky, vytvárať súbory PDF a analyzovať súbory XML.
⬤ Učte sa bezpečné skripty, spracovanie chýb, ladenie výkonu a ďalšie pokročilé témy.
⬤ Získajte rýchly prehľad o základných funkciách PHP a štandardných rozšíreniach.